Cerrion offers industry-specific AI Agents that come pre-built to match common manufacturing processes (Food & Beverage, Glass Packaging, Tableware, Sawmilling and Wood Processing, and CPG). The platform connects to existing cameras or Cerrion hardware and uses pre-trained visual triggers to monitor process, quality, safety, and OEE. When issues are detected, the agents can take automated actions and escalate as needed, enabling rapid root-cause analysis, faster decision making, and measurable ROI from day one.
